Station Facilities and Amenities

Bromley Cross (Lancs) simplifies your travel with essential amenities. For ticketing, the station is equipped with accessible ticket machines, making it easy to collect tickets purchased online. A helpful induction loop is available for those needing auditory assistance. Although the station itself isn't staffed around the clock, customer help points ensure assistance is available when you need it most. Car park users will find the space open 24 hours with over 70 spaces available, an added benefit being free parking.

Accessibility is given considerable attention. Though there aren't accessible toilets or set-down/pick-up points specifically marked for impaired mobility, the station provides step-free access to certain areas, ensuring a smoother experience for passengers with limited mobility. Unfortunately, basic facilities like refreshment kiosks, ATMs, or shops are absent, so be sure to bring anything you'll need with you before arriving.

Links to Other Transport Options

Traveling onward from Bromley Cross is straightforward. The station's transport connections include a rail replacement service, conveniently located at a nearby bus stop opposite the Railway Pub. For taxi services, details are available online through a convenient link, ensuring a seamless continuation of your journey. Bus services offer another viable option, with planning information accessible via a printable poster from National Rail. While there isn’t an underground or metro service available directly, Greater Manchester’s transport service can be contacted for wider metro plans at 0161 228 7811.

The Essentials: Kempston Hardwick Station Amenities

Kempston Hardwick may be small, but it serves as a vital link for travelers heading to various UK locales. When traveling from this station, it's crucial to keep in mind that there isn’t a ticket office or ticket collection machine. Although tickets need to be purchased online or at other stations, the station does feature valuable resources like departure screens and customer help points. While not staffed directly, it offers a help point for information and a customer service contact center that's eager to assist during regular hours.

Accessibility is partially catered for with step-free access available to parts of the station. However, while planning your trip, note that there are no accessible facilities such as toilets or waiting rooms, yet a seating area is available for a brief respite while you wait for your train.

Onward Journey: Transport Connections

Despite its rural setting, Kempston Hardwick offers some essential transport services to ensure your journey continues seamlessly. When rail services are halted, replacement buses are at the ready from the gravel turning circle, located near the entrance to the Bletchley-bound platform.
